Meeting English – A1 Lesson 2: People and Roles

Level: A1 | Topic: Business Meetings

📚 Vocabulary

WordTypeDefinitionExample
hostnounthe person who organises and runs the meetingThe host welcomes everyone at the start.
guestnouna person who is invited to attendWe have a guest from the London office today.
managernouna person who is in charge of a teamThe manager will present the monthly results.
teamnouna group of people who work togetherThe whole team is in the meeting room.
membernounone person in a group or teamEvery member must give a short update.
organiseverbto plan and prepare somethingCan you organise the next meeting?
inviteverbto ask someone to come to a meetingPlease invite all department heads.
presentverbto show or explain something to a groupShe will present the new project today.
notenouna short piece of writing to help you rememberPlease take notes during the meeting.
introduceverbto tell others who someone is for the first timeLet me introduce our new team member.
